Troop of gelada baboons C017 / 7633

Troop of gelada baboons (Theropithecus gelada) at the bottom of a cliff. This baboon inhabits the grasslands areas of the highlands in Eritrea and Ethiopia. Males lead small troops consisting of females and their offspring. They may merge with other groups in rich feeding grounds. It is the only primate gramnivore (feeding mainly on grasses). Photographed in the Debre Libanos gorge, Ethiopia

This print captures a troop of gelada baboons (Theropithecus gelada) at the bottom of a cliff in the Debre Libanos gorge, Ethiopia. These remarkable primates inhabit the grasslands areas of the highlands in Eritrea and Ethiopia, forming small troops led by dominant males. The troop consists of females and their offspring, often merging with other groups in search of rich feeding grounds. What sets these baboons apart is their unique dietary preference - they are the only primate gramnivores, primarily feeding on grasses. This herbivorous behavior makes them an intriguing subject for biologists studying primate ecology and evolution. In this photograph, we witness a diverse range of individuals within the troop. From young to adult baboons, both male and female members can be seen socializing and foraging amidst rocky surroundings. Their interactions provide valuable insights into their social dynamics as well as their biological adaptations to survive in challenging environments.
